Description

The B. Braun Meropenem Duplex Container for Injection USP and Sodium Chloride Injection USP (24/Case) is a Duplex two-compartment flexible IV container that comes in both one gram and two grams sizes.

Warranty: Not Available.

Designed to store pre-measured drug and diluent doses separately until administration, the Meropenem Duplex Container is extremely easy to use and works in conjunction with automated dispensing system - just label and dispense.This top-of-the-line container is conveniently activated at the patient's bedside and boasts a 50 mL delivery size. It also meets the Joint Commission and USP 797 guidelines.

Specifications

B. Braun Meropenem Duplex Container for Injection USP and Sodium Chloride Injection USP Specifications

Configuration Total Shelf Life (Months) Ordering Unit Units per Case Dimensions per Case Shipping Weight per Case
500 mg Meropenem for Injection USP and Sodium Chloride Injection USP 24 Case 24 5.709 x 12.283 x 5.866 inches 4.079 lb
1 G Meropenem for Injection USP and Sodium Chloride Injection USP 24 Case 24 5.748 x 12.205 x 5.827 inches. 4.189 lb

Sizes

B. Braun Meropenem Duplex Container for Injection USP and Sodium Chloride Injection USP Sizes

  • #3183-11: 500 mg.
  • #3185-11: 1 Gram.
